    The Chronicle of Higher Education

    The Chronicle of Higher Education is the professional news source for faculty members, academic officers and senior administrative officers who run colleges and universities in the U.S., Canada, and abroad. The publication overs news and trends affecting higher education, and includes coverage of scholarships, information technology, business and philanthropy, personal and professional news, government and political actions, listings of books, computer software, gifts and grants to colleges, tenure, appointments, retirement benefits, academic freedom, plagiarism, teaching, academic meetings, and a bulletin board. Founded in 1966 and originally owned by a nonprofit, in 1978 The Chronicle was sold to Jack Crowl and Corbin Gwaltney, and The Chronicle of Higher Education Inc. was formed.

    GlobalCapital

    Previously titled EuroWeek, GlobalCapital is a weekly magazine that provides information on the global capital markets spanning Asia, the Middle East, Europe, Africa and the Americas. Since relaunching as GlobalCapital in February 2014, the title has incorporated AsiaMoney, Derivatives Week and Total Securitization. It is published by Euromoney Institutional Investor plc. Audience and Readership: The magazine is aimed at capital markets professionals Deadline: The editorial deadline is Thursday, in the week before Easter the deadline is on a Wednesday. Time of Publication: The magazine is published on Friday. Frequency: Weekly, plus daily email bulletins covering EM, FIG, loans, leveraged loans, corporate bonds, SSA bonds, derivatives, equities and structured finance in the EU and US. Distribution: The magazine is available via subscription in print and digital format.
